Here are some issues I am having with Word 2007:
- When I click on "Word Options," I can only access the "Popular" tab and not the others such as "Display," "Proofing," etc. - The vertical scrollbar does not work. - Double-clicking on a Word icon opens the program, but not the file. There is another thread discussing this issue, but it has morphed into a discussion of Word2003. I installed Word 2007 and, at that time, decided to keep my Off2003 apps still installed, including Word 2003. Before I discovered these issues in Word, I uninstalled Off2003. Now, all I have on my computer is Off2007 apps. It has been suggested that this errant behavior was due to the fact that I was using an unactivated trial version. Since then, I have purchased the full (upgrade) version and have activated all my Off2007 apps. Sadly, this has had no effect on the Word issue as described above. HELP!!! |

Hi Stephany,
There are some 3rd party add-ins that can cause this. Laserfiche and FlashPaper are two mentioned. ============ "Stephany" wrote in message ...
